Output 51430e892d79d3e5148cc1e9dc61c2cf7851b0d6831bc85467e81844b04fdefe:15

value
259336900
script pubkey
OP_0 OP_PUSHBYTES_20 45aff98d5e53aa4bea361adc1894dfd6388e7381
address
ltc1qgkhlnr272w4yh63krtwp39xl6cuguuuprp5w7e
transaction
51430e892d79d3e5148cc1e9dc61c2cf7851b0d6831bc85467e81844b04fdefe
spent
true